Italy:FA.NI. launches Roving Stop Motion device |
2004-9-1
|
 |
FA.NI. has launched a new range of a Roving Stop Motion devices for ring spinning frames. The ROVING STOP MOTION BP-06 is a device, which makes it possible to stop the roving feed under the drafting arm following a yarn break in ring spinning frames.
The main advantages of the Roving Stop Motion are: - Reduced waste (pneumafil): without the Roving Stop Motion, after a break, the roving continues to be drafted, is removed by the suction tubes and ends up in the pneumafil. - Solution to the problem of lap forming: by preventing direct damage to the drafting unit (cots and aprons, etc…) or indirect damage caused by the operator during lap removal.
With the new Roving Stop Motion BP-06 Twin-Stop FANI introduces new advantages compared to the classic Roving Stop Motion.
In fact, the Roving Stop Motion devices available on the market stop the roving feed between the two feed rollers. Therefore the portion of the roving, which has already come out of the feed rollers will in any case be drafted and consequently sucked into the pneumafil.
The Roving Stop Motion BP-06 Twin-Stop will stop roving between both, middle and delivery rollers.
Further, considerable reduction of the pneumafil can be obtained with the BP-06 Twin-Stop. In fact, the pneumafil which is produced is the result of: - Active pneumafil produced by the breaks. - Passive pneumafil produced by the normal suction during the spinning process.
Generally, the passive pneumafil is greater in quantity than the active pneumafil.
The classic Roving Stop Motion only acts on the active pneumafil, whereas the BP-06 Twin-Stop can also act on the passive pneumafil. In fact, the complete and immediate stop of the roving inside the drafting zone after an end break allows reducing the suction power reducing passive pneumafil.
FA.NI based in Italy, and has been present in the textile automation and control industry since 1975. |
